Game description: Someone has taken verses from the Bible and hidden them in the forest. Gil needs your help to
search through the forest, find the missing verses and return them to the correct Book of the Bible.
Gil's Bible Jumble features beautiful cartoon graphics, many different soundtracks and is completely narrated by
Gil so that it can be played by children who can not read. It is your job to help guide Gil on an adventure through
the forest visiting different books of the Bible and helping to find and return the correct missing verses to them.
This is a great computer game for kids to learn many different verses from the Bible. It is impossible for anyone to
lose. Even very small children that can not read yet can play on the smallest map and just through random clicking
will win the game and have a lot of fun. And while playing, they will hear many different Bible verses read to them
by Gil. For the older or more advanced player it will be challenging to return the verse not only to the correct book
of the Bible, but also to identify the correct chapter and verse for bonus points!
Each time you play Gil's Bible Jumble you will get a different map, so you can play Gil's Bible Jumble many times
and get a different game every time.

The Axys Adventures are an entertaining mix of mysteries, puzzles, exploration and combat. It is also a story – a story in
which you are the main character, a story which you discover as you play.
In the game, you play the part of Axys – a youth who lives on Pacifico Island, which is part of an imaginary world called
The Sea Lands. While Pacifico is normally a very wonderful and peaceful place, certain individuals there have been
listening to lies, and as a result, the citizens will soon need your help. Taking up your sword, you must battle the
malicious and willful weeds that have mysteriously appeared in Pacifico’s fertile soil. You will need your blade, your skill
and your wits. But you will not be able to defeat the source of the trouble until you can challenge the lies that are
behind it all.
When you have conquered the lie that has troubled Pacifico, other parts of the Sea Lands will call for your help. Penu
Harbor and Tramata Village are slowly engulfed by strange troubles. Once more you must combine your skill with the
sword and your ability to solve curious puzzles to bring about a confrontation with the lies that have created the
problems. Dangers abound, and every new discovery buzzes with excitement. You must be careful or the Sea Lands will
be doomed. But if you hold to the truth, you cannot be defeated!

Students guide "Robin MacTavish" through the underground ruins of Joseph's palace recently
discovered (or created by us as it were) beneath the Egyptian sands. Joseph has left his amazing
story behind in his amazing palace for all posterity. But he's also made it challenging.
As Robin is guided through the ruins, they trace the path of the story of Joseph --the coat of many
colors, the dreams, the well rejection by brothers, Potiphar's house, Pharoah's prison, the Baker
and Cupbearer's dreams, service to Pharoah, and reconciliation with his brothers.
When Robin gets too close to the well, she falls in it and the real adventure begins. The game
begins to think Robin is Joseph. The slave traders come after her, Potiphar's guards arrest her,
Pharaoh speaks with her. Only when Robin finds Joseph's cup do the game/ruins return to normal.
When Robin finds her Grandpa Dabney at the dig, she gives him the cup which triggers a final
event in which Robin can go hear what is in the brothers' hearts --and learn the true meaning of
the Joseph story.
The ruins themselves contain numerous stop & ponder Bible studies left there by the Dig crew.

Bongo Knows the Bible ~ is a four level Bible Knowledge game testing basic Bible content
in a fun 3-D jungle game environment. The questions are NOT trivial. They are Bible basics
and questions about the key stories and key Bible people every young person should
know. The four levels range from beginner to advanced and were especially designed for
4th through 12th graders. The beginner level is easy for younger children if they have help.
Bongo Needs the Bible~ is a game about the importance of reading the Bible, the benefits of
knowing God's word, and things which will help you learn and follow God's word. It takes place in a
cave where Bongo must learn to find the lamp for his feet and the true light. Great for discussion too.
Bongo's Books of the Bible~ is a game where students guide Bongo across treacherous canyons
by landing him on the correct books of the Old or New Testament -in order, while avoiding falling
rocks and nagging crows. Players will run into scrolls that teach them the correct order prior to coming
up to the canyons. As each book platform is jumped on, a short summary of its content appears.
Bongo's Bible Background~ is a game in which students find and study information about "how the
Bible came to be" and complete a quiz about what they read, while avoiding Bongo-eating plants, and
slinging bananas.
Counting the four independent levels of Bongo Knows the Bible, and the choice of working
on either Old OR New Testament books, Bongo has a total of EIGHT GAMES -each designed
to be played in 30 minutes or less (depending on student ability and age).

Students select a verse they want to study. They have 30 seconds to study it, then the verse is
scrambled. Then the clock starts ticking and they have to drag the words into the correct order. When
done, Cal or Marty have a few words and then a "verse comment window" appears and 3 question quiz
pops up. Cal & Marty are there the whole time watching you and talking to you.
You or your students EDIT IN THE VERSE, create the COMMENTS, and add up to a 3 question QUIZ about
the verse. The game comes with several verses to get you started.
